✅ Step 1: Deconstruct Your Market Fundamentals

Before you can conquer a market, you must understand its very essence. This initial step is about laying a solid foundation by meticulously defining your playing field and identifying the forces that shape it.

Define Your Arena: What Market Are You Truly In?

  • ✅ Clearly identify your core industry, primary sub-sectors, and any adjacent or emerging markets that could impact your trajectory. Avoid broad generalizations; specificity is key.
  • ✅ Analyze market size, growth rates, and overall maturity (e.g., nascent, growth, mature, declining).

Understand Macro & Micro Forces

  • ✅ Conduct a comprehensive PESTLE (Political, Economic, Social, Technological, Legal, Environmental) analysis to map external macro-environmental factors.
  • ✅ Apply Porter's Five Forces (Threat of New Entrants, Bargaining Power of Buyers, Threat of Substitute Products, Bargaining Power of Suppliers, Industry Rivalry) to understand the micro-environmental competitive landscape.
  • ✅ Pinpoint key market drivers (technological shifts, regulatory changes, demographic trends) and potential barriers to entry or growth.

✅ Step 3: Segment, Target, and Position (STP) with Precision

The market is rarely monolithic. Success lies in identifying the most fertile ground for your offerings and communicating your unique value effectively.

Granular Market Segmentation

  • ✅ Break down the total market into distinct segments using criteria such as demographics (age, income), psychographics (lifestyle, values), behavioral patterns (usage rate, loyalty), and geographic location.
  • ✅ Develop detailed buyer personas for your ideal customers within each segment, including their goals, challenges, decision-making processes, and preferred communication channels.

Strategic Target Market Selection

  • ✅ Evaluate each identified segment for its attractiveness (size, growth potential), accessibility (ability to reach), and profitability (revenue potential vs. cost to serve).
  • ✅ Select specific target segments that align best with your organizational capabilities, resources, and strategic objectives.
  • ✅ Validate target segments through pilot programs or limited market tests to gauge actual demand and viability.

Crafting an Irresistible Value Proposition & Positioning

  • ✅ Articulate a clear, concise, and compelling value proposition that highlights the unique benefits you offer to your chosen target segments.
  • ✅ Develop a distinctive market positioning strategy that differentiates your brand from competitors in the minds of your customers.
  • ✅ Ensure your messaging consistently communicates your competitive advantages and addresses your target customers' specific needs and desires.

✅ Step 4: Develop a Dynamic Market Entry & Growth Strategy

Once you know your market and your target, the next step is to strategize how to enter it and, more importantly, how to sustain and accelerate your growth within it.

Entry Modes: Weighing Your Options

  • ✅ Evaluate various market entry strategies: direct sales, indirect channels (distributors, agents), licensing, franchising, joint ventures, or strategic acquisitions.
  • ✅ Select the optimal market entry mode based on your risk tolerance, available resources, market characteristics, and long-term strategic goals.

Growth Levers: Expand and Diversify

  • ✅ Implement strategies for market penetration (increasing sales of existing products in existing markets) and product development (new products for existing markets).
  • ✅ Explore market development (existing products into new markets) and diversification (new products into new markets) to unlock new revenue streams and spread risk.
  • ✅ Continuously scout for new distribution channels, geographic expansion opportunities, and strategic partnerships that can amplify your market reach.

Understanding your market requires a robust toolkit of metrics. Here's a quick reference for essential market analysis metrics:

Metric Description Why it Matters
TAM (Total Addressable Market) Maximum possible revenue if you captured 100% of the market. Informs long-term strategic vision and investor appeal.
SAM (Serviceable Available Market) The portion of TAM you can realistically serve with your current business model. Guides sales and marketing efforts, operational capacity planning.
SOM (Serviceable Obtainable Market) The share of SAM you can realistically capture within a specific timeframe. Establishes realistic revenue targets and resource allocation.
Market Share Your company's sales as a percentage of total market sales. Indicates competitive standing and market influence.
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C) The cost associated with convincing a prospective customer to buy a product/service. Crucial for evaluating marketing efficiency and profitability.
Customer Lifetime Value (CLTV) The predicted total revenue a customer will generate over their relationship with a company. Informs long-term customer relationship strategies and ROI.
